Aproskopos

ap-ros'-kop-os
Parts of Speech Adjective

Aproskopos Definition

NAS Word Usage - Total: 3
  1. having nothing to strike against, not causing to stumble
    1. of a smooth road
    2. metaph. of not leading others to sin by one's mode of life
  2. not striking against or stumbling
    1. metaph. not led into sin, blameless
  3. without offense, not troubled by a consciousness of sin
